异或运算是定义在二进制数基础上的逻辑位运算, 由于其具有的可逆运算特性, 被很多对称加密算法所采用, 成为其加密运算的基础算法. DES算法作为对称加密算法的典型代表, 其非线性部件的基础算法也同样采用了异或运算. 由此可见, 异或算法在加密算法中具有重要地位. 正因为异或算法是二值逻辑运算, 这也将目前对称加密算法的应用基本上都限定在了基于二进制数的运算上. 随着信息技术的不断发展, 很多领域(如电子商务、商品防伪码、预付费表计、电子货币等)都有对十进制数进行等位加密运算的需求, 也就是对一个定长位数的十进制数串进行加密, 密文仍然是一个等长的十进制数串, 而目前的对称加密算法基本上都不能满足要求. 本文提出了一种广义上的位异或算法,将二值异或算法扩展到任意n进制数上. 该算法继承了二值位异或算法的可逆运算特性, 满足了对DES算法的扩展需求, 并由此提出了基于该算法的DES增强算法. 实验表明, 该算法具有优良的密码学特性. DES增强算法是定义在任意有限集合F(n>1)上的对称分组加密算法, 可实现对任意有限数量的符号集进行等位加密运算(比如对26个英文字母组成的字符串序列进行26或52进制的加密,密文与原文可等长,符号集不会超出英文字母集). 本文以十进制为例, 给出了十进制DES增强算法的具体实现, 并探讨了算法的实现可行性及安全性.
2021-10-25 18:12:18 391KB 十进制 10进制 多进制 异或
【信号处理】基于多进制数字振幅调制与解调(4APK)matlab源码
2021-10-24 18:10:53 4KB
1
多进制纠错码LDPC编译码matlab算法仿真程序,有注释说明
2021-09-28 18:04:00 360KB LDPC 多进制LDPC
多进制载波相位调制解调系统仿真与实现.doc
2021-09-19 09:04:07 425KB 文档
一种多进制LDPC码设计方法,蔡琛,黄勤,目前二进制LDPC码已得到了广泛的应用。将LDPC码由二进制扩展到多进制可以在较短或中等码长时获得更加接近香农限的性能。在码长及码�
2021-07-27 05:48:43 623KB 通信与信息系统
1
可控多进制计数器,两片74160,双四选一数据选择器74153以及扫描电路组成。功能强大,亲测可用,绝对不坑。
2021-07-13 14:38:59 44KB 计数器
1
一、实验目的 3 二、实验原理 3 三、实验工具 4 四、实验方案 5 4.1 2ASK、4ASK抗噪声性能的比较 5 4.1.1 2ASK系统设计 5 4.1.2 4ASK系统设计 6 4.1.3 系统运行结果 8 4.2 2FSK、4FSK抗噪声性能的比较 9 4.2.1 2FSK系统设计 9 4.2.2 4FSK系统设计 11 4.3 2PSK、4PSK、8PSK抗噪声性能的比较 15 4.4探究影响抗噪声性能的因素 17 五、实验结果分析 18 5.1误码率结果分析 18 5.2影响抗噪声性能的因素 20 六、实验总结 20
2021-07-05 18:01:39 1.27MB simulink MATLAB 通信原理
1
基于Matlab的多进制数字调制仿真.pdf
2021-07-03 21:00:10 231KB MATLAB 数据分析 仿真研究 论文期刊
多进制数字调制的特点 由信息传输速率Rb、码元传输速率RB和进制数M之间的关系 由关系式 信息传输速率不变,增加进制数M,可以降低码元传输速率,减小信号带宽,节约频带资源,提高系统频带利用率 码元传输速率不变的情况下,通过增加进制数M,可以增大信息传输速率,从而在相同的带宽中传输更多的信息量。
2021-05-30 10:19:05 1.34MB 通信工程 电信 移动
1
// A non-binary LDPC decoding simulator // // This decoder is extended from a decoder by // // Seishi Takamura @ Stanford University / NTT (Nippon Telegraph and Telephone) 多进制LDPC码译码算法,有助于帮助研究多元LDPC码的研究生、博士生,代码基于C++平台,运行良好,译码结果与文献相符合。
2021-05-17 17:50:06 974KB NB LDPC 多进制 译码
1